Requirements:

Conditions for credit are: a maximum of 8 absences and at least one-third of the points from mini-tests.

The exam is oral, with primary emphasis on formulating problems and understanding basic concepts, including the principles of the relevant mathematical theorems and statements.

Syllabus of lectures:

1. Continuation of differential calculus: Taylors formula, Taylor polynomials

2. Numerical series: Convergence criteria, absolute and conditional convergence, operations with series

3. Integral calculus: Antiderivatives, integration methods, definite integral (Riemann definition) and its applications, improper Riemann integral

4. Power series (in real and complex domains): CauchyHadamard theorem, expansion of a real function into a power series, determination of the series sum

Syllabus of tutorials:

1. Calculation of limits using LHospitals rule

2. Function approximation using Taylor polynomials

3. Convergence of series

4. Finding antiderivatives

5. Calculation of areas and volumes

6. Expansion of a function into a power series
